COVID graphicIs the worst of theCOVID-19 pandemic behind us? As states and businesses reopen, manyhope so, even as the country braces for a potential second wavewhile researchers work furiously to create a vaccine and maketesting more reliable and widely available.

Life will never go back to the way it was, however, and thatsimple fact carries with it lasting repercussions on businesses andthe economy. Many jobs, particularly in the service and hospitalityindustries, will not return.
